Renewable Resources Logistics Market Key Trends
The Renewable Resources Logistics Market is poised for substantial growth between 2025 and 2032, driven by technological advancements and sustainability initiatives. Key trends shaping the market include:
Digitalization and Automation:
Integration of AI, IoT, and machine learning for smart logistics management is gaining traction. These technologies enhance real-time tracking, optimize routes, and predict delivery timelines, improving overall efficiency.
Automated warehouses and smart inventory systems are becoming common in renewable resource supply chains to reduce costs and minimize waste.
Sustainability-driven Innovation:
Logistics providers are increasingly adopting eco-friendly solutions, including electric vehicles (EVs), alternative fuels, and energy-efficient transport systems.
The shift toward carbon-neutral logistics and emission reduction policies is pushing companies to adopt greener practices.
Increased Investment in Renewable Infrastructure:
Governments are heavily investing in renewable energy infrastructure, creating demand for specialized logistics solutions to manage the transportation and distribution of materials such as solar panels, wind turbines, and bioenergy components.
Blockchain Integration:
Blockchain is being adopted to improve supply chain transparency, ensuring the traceability of renewable resources from origin to end user.
Rising Demand for Circular Economy Models:
Industries are increasingly recycling materials, requiring specialized logistics solutions to handle reverse logistics and the redistribution of repurposed resources.

Renewable Resources Logistics Market Segmentation
By Type:
Road Transport: Preferred for short-distance movement of renewable energy components.
Rail Transport: Ideal for large-scale equipment like wind turbine blades.
Sea Freight: Key for international transport of bulk renewable materials.
Air Freight: Used for urgent deliveries and specialized parts.
By Application:
Wind Energy Logistics: Requires heavy-duty transport for turbines and blades.
Solar Energy Logistics: Involves precise handling of fragile solar panels.
Bioenergy Logistics: Involves managing biomass transport and waste-to-energy chains.
By End User:
Energy Companies: Require bulk material transportation for large-scale renewable projects.
Construction Firms: Need logistics support for infrastructure development.
Government Bodies: Focus on public-sector renewable initiatives and installations.

Renewable Resources Logistics Market Restraints
High Initial Investment Costs:
The deployment of smart logistics systems, electric fleets, and automated warehousing requires significant capital investment.
Geographical Challenges:
Remote locations for renewable energy projects increase transport complexity and costs.
Regulatory Barriers:
Varying environmental and transport regulations across regions complicate logistics planning.
Lack of Skilled Workforce:
The need for specialized professionals to manage renewable logistics processes is a key limiting factor.
